Benefits and Drawbacks of a 35 Loan
Taking out financing for your dream home can be a significant step . A 35-year loan offers numerous benefits , such as lower monthly payments . This makes it more financially feasible for buyers to obtain their desired property. However, a 35-year loan also comes with certain drawbacks . A significant consideration is the cumulative finance charges , which can be considerable over such an extended duration . Additionally, a long-term commitment may impact your ability to invest in other areas.

Other Financing Solutions to Consider Instead of a 35 Loan
If the conventional route of securing a 35 loan feels restrictive or unattainable, you're not alone. A plethora of innovative financing options are available to explore, catering to diverse financial situations and goals. Consider alternatives like peer-to-peer lending platforms, which connect borrowers directly with individual investors, often at competitive interest rates. Factoring companies can provide immediate cash flow by purchasing your outstanding invoices at a discount. For entrepreneurs, crowdfunding campaigns can tap into the collective support of a passionate audience to fuel growth. Before committing to a traditional loan, it's essential to research these alternative paths and determine which best aligns with your needs and circumstances.
